In 1967, a cannery was established in Lebedyan, Lipetsk Oblast, around 350 kilometers south of Moscow.
In 1996, Lebedyansky launched its first branded product, "Tonus Juice" and in 1998, the company management decided to pursue a major expansion.
Until the spring of 2008, the main owners of the company were State Duma deputy Nikolay Bortsov (30% of shares), his son Yuri Bortsov (25.13%), Olga Belyavtseva (18.4%), Dmitry Fadeev (2%); 23% of the company's shares were in free circulation.
In November 2009, Lebedyansky Holdings increased its stake to 100%, reducing the authorized capital by redeeming part of the outstanding ordinary shares.
